Ativar relatório de fluxo

Escolha se deseja gerar detalhes de execução para todos os itens Flow Designer, execuções, apenas para itens individuais ou apenas ao testar um item. Especifique o nível de detalhe que os detalhes da execução contêm.

Ativar relatórios para um fluxo, subfluxo ou ação individual

Gere detalhes de execução para um fluxo, subfluxo ou ação individual sempre que ele for executado, não apenas durante o teste.

Antes de Iniciar

Função necessária: admin ou flow_operator

Por Que e Quando Desempenhar Esta Tarefa

Importante:
Para evitar problemas de desempenho em sua instância de produção, ative e configure o relatório na instância de não produção que você usa para testes.
Você pode ativar o relatório para um fluxo, subfluxo ou ação individual criando um registro na tabela Configurações [sys_flow_execution_setting]. Cada registro de configurações especifica o fluxo, subfluxo ou ação para gerar detalhes de execução e o nível de detalhe a ser usado. Você pode criar quantos registros de Configurações quiser. O sistema gera detalhes de execução sempre que o fluxo, subfluxo ou ação é executado diretamente. Ações ou subfluxos que são executados a partir de um fluxo primário usam o registro de Configurações do fluxo primário.
Nota:
Você pode chamar ações e subfluxos diretamente usando a API de ação ou a API de script.

Procedimento

  1. Navegar até Todos > Automação de Processo > Administração do Fluxo > Configurações.
    O sistema exibe a lista de itens individuais para os quais o relatório de fluxo está ativado.
  2. No campo Fluxo/Subfluxo/Ação, selecione o ícone de pesquisa (ícone de pesquisa) para selecionar o tipo de item para o qual você deseja ativar o relatório.
    O sistema exibe uma caixa de diálogo para selecionar o tipo e a instância específica.
  3. No campo Nome da tabela, selecione a tabela correspondente para o item.
    OpçãoDescrição
    Fluxo Tabela para fluxos e subfluxos
    Tipo de ação Tabela usada para ações
  4. No campo Documento, selecione o ícone de pesquisa ( ícone de pesquisa).
    O sistema exibe uma lista de itens do tipo correspondente.
  5. Selecione o fluxo, subfluxo ou ação individual para o qual você deseja ativar o relatório.
  6. Selecione OK para fechar a caixa de diálogo.
  7. No campo Relatório, selecione os dados de tempo de execução de nível a serem gerados e exibidos nos detalhes de execução do fluxo.
    Desligado
    O sistema não gera detalhes de execução de fluxo. O sistema só gera detalhes de execução quando você executa um teste.
    Nota:
    Testar uma ação ou fluxo gera detalhes de execução no nível de rastreamento.
    Básico: somente estados de tempo de execução e durações
    O sistema gera detalhes de execução de tempo de execução para cada fluxo, subfluxo e execução de ação. Você pode ver o estado de tempo de execução e a duração desses itens básicos. Você também pode ver valores de configuração e tempo de execução para gatilhos de fluxo, entradas de subfluxo e saídas de subfluxo.
    Total: valores de configuração de ação e tempo de execução (somente para depuração)
    O sistema gera detalhes de configuração e execução de tempo de execução para cada fluxo, subfluxo e execução de ação. Você pode ver o estado de tempo de execução, a duração, os valores de entrada e os valores de saída de todos os itens. Para ações personalizadas, você também pode ver o estado de tempo de execução, a duração, os valores de entrada e os valores de saída de suas etapas. Você também pode ver os valores de configuração de gatilhos de fluxo, subfluxos, ações e etapas que fazem parte de uma ação personalizada.
    Rastreamento: todos os valores (somente para teste e suporte)
    O sistema gera detalhes de configuração e execução de tempo de execução para cada fluxo, subfluxo, ação e execução de etapa. Você pode ver o estado de tempo de execução, a duração, os valores de entrada e os valores de saída de todos os itens. Você também pode ver os valores de configuração de gatilhos de fluxo, subfluxos, ações e etapas.
    Nota:
    Testar uma ação ou fluxo gera detalhes de execução no nível de rastreamento.
  8. Selecione Enviar.

Resultado

Flow Designer sempre gera detalhes de execução para o fluxo, subfluxo ou ação individual.

Ativar relatório para todos os itens

Gere detalhes de execução para todos os itens que Flow Designer executa em vez de apenas gerar detalhes de execução durante o teste.

Antes de Iniciar

Função necessária: administrador

Por Que e Quando Desempenhar Esta Tarefa

Importante:
Para evitar problemas de desempenho em sua instância de produção, ative e configure o relatório na instância de não produção que você usa para testes.

Por padrão, o sistema só gera detalhes de execução quando você executa um teste. Você pode ativar o relatório para todos os itens que Flow Designer é executado definindo a propriedade do sistema com.snc.process_flow.reporting.level.

Procedimento

  1. Navegar até Todos > Automação de Processo > Propriedades.
  2. Defina a propriedade Nível de dados de relatório gerados pelo mecanismo de fluxo.
    Desligado
    O sistema não gera detalhes de execução de fluxo. O sistema só gera detalhes de execução quando você executa um teste.
    Nota:
    Testar uma ação ou fluxo gera detalhes de execução no nível de rastreamento.
    Básico: somente estados de tempo de execução e durações
    O sistema gera detalhes de execução de tempo de execução para cada fluxo, subfluxo e execução de ação. Você pode ver o estado de tempo de execução e a duração desses itens básicos. Você também pode ver valores de configuração e tempo de execução para gatilhos de fluxo, entradas de subfluxo e saídas de subfluxo.
    Total: valores de configuração de ação e tempo de execução (somente para depuração)
    O sistema gera detalhes de configuração e execução de tempo de execução para cada fluxo, subfluxo e execução de ação. Você pode ver o estado de tempo de execução, a duração, os valores de entrada e os valores de saída de todos os itens. Para ações personalizadas, você também pode ver o estado de tempo de execução, a duração, os valores de entrada e os valores de saída de suas etapas. Você também pode ver os valores de configuração de gatilhos de fluxo, subfluxos, ações e etapas que fazem parte de uma ação personalizada.
    Rastreamento: todos os valores (somente para teste e suporte)
    O sistema gera detalhes de configuração e execução de tempo de execução para cada fluxo, subfluxo, ação e execução de etapa. Você pode ver o estado de tempo de execução, a duração, os valores de entrada e os valores de saída de todos os itens. Você também pode ver os valores de configuração de gatilhos de fluxo, subfluxos, ações e etapas.
    Nota:
    Testar uma ação ou fluxo gera detalhes de execução no nível de rastreamento.
    Aviso:
    Evite habilitar a opção de relatório completo em uma instância de produção. O relatório completo gera detalhes de execução para cada fluxo e ação executada na instância. Criar e armazenar esses detalhes de execução consome memória do sistema e pode diminuir o desempenho do sistema. Em vez disso, habilite a geração de relatórios somente para fluxos e ações específicos ou teste-os em uma instância que não seja de produção.
  3. Selecione Salvar.

Resultado

Flow Designer gera detalhes de execução para todos os itens especificados na propriedade do sistema.